How much does it cost to rent a home in Sunrise?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Sunrise 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,138 | $1,200 | $4,350 |
| Sunrise 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,196 | $1,950 | $7,700 |
| Sunrise 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,800 | $2,650 | $10,000+ |
| Sunrise 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$10,609 | $3,200 | $10,000+ |
| Sunrise 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$13,125 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|
| Sunrise 7 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$13,247 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Sunrise
What type of rentals are currently available in Sunrise?
There are currently 602 Apartments for Rent in Sunrise, FL with pricing that ranges from $850 to $7,300. There are also 912 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Sunrise ranging from $500 to $40,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Sunrise?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Sunrise ranges from $500 to $40,000 with an average monthly rent of $9,428.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Sunrise?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Sunrise range from $1,808 to $4,619,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,950 to $7,700.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,650 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$4,286.
